The Landscape of Spanish Pharmacies (Farmacias)
In Spain, the traditional brick-and-mortar pharmacy-- recognized by the glowing green cross (Cruz Verde)-- is a pillar of neighborhood healthcare. Pharmacists in Spain are extremely qualified doctor who typically provide standard medical diagnoses, administer vaccinations, and offer medical guidance without needing a prior physician's visit.
However, the concept of a "mail order pharmacy" looks various in Spain compared to nations like the United States.
- Strict Regulations: Spain does not enable the mail-order shipment of prescription-only medications (POMs) from conventional Pedir analgésicos online en España storefronts in the method US mail-order services operate.
- The EU Exception: Thanks to European Union cross-border healthcare regulations, clients can sometimes source medications from other EU countries under specific conditions, offered they have a valid prescription.
- Over The Counter (OTC) Freedom: While prescription drugs can not be sent by mail, non-prescription medications, organic supplements, and parapharmacy products can be lawfully ordered online and provided to one's doorstep.

For those aiming to purchase authorized OTC medications or parapharmacy items Analgésicos online en España within Spain, safety is paramount. The internet is regrettably occupied by illegal operations offering fake or expired drugs.
To ensure an online pharmacy operating in Spain is legitimate, consumers must search for particular trust markers:
- The EU Common Logo: All legal online drug stores in Spain and the EU should show a typical logo on every page of their website that offers medicines. Clicking this logo should reroute the user to the official government registry (AEMPS) validating the drug store's permission.
- Physical Address Verification: Legitimate online drug stores in Spain must be connected to a physical, brick-and-mortar farmacia signed up with the local Official College of Pharmacists (Colegio Oficial de Farmacéuticos).
- Transparent Contact Information: A valid Spanish phone number, physical address, and client service email must be plainly noted on the website.
Sourcing Prescription Medications from Abroad: Cross-Border Rules
For expatriates and long-lasting visitors who depend on routine prescription refills, managing medications in Spain requires tactical preparation. Due to the fact that a standard Spain mail order drug store can not deliver local prescription drugs straight to Analgésicos a la Venta en España home address, patients typically utilize one of the following techniques:
- The Spanish National Health System (Sistema Nacional de Salud - SNS): Residents registered in the general public health care system receive an electronic health card (Tarjeta Sanitaria). Medical professionals release electronic prescriptions (receta electrónica), which can be filled at any physical drug store in the area utilizing the card.
- Personal Healthcare: Patients utilizing private insurance can acquire paper or digital prescriptions from private doctors and take them to any physical pharmacy.
- Cross-Border EU Prescriptions: Under Directive 2011/24/EU, clients can use a prescription released in one EU nation to buy medication in another EU nation. However, the physical medication should still be given by a certified, physical pharmacy or adhere strictly to the receiving nation's import laws.
Alternative Solutions for Expats and Travelers
If you are accustomed to the benefit of automated mail-order prescription shipment systems from your home country, adapting to the Spanish system can take time. Consider these practical workarounds:
- 90-Day Supplies from Home: If checking out Spain momentarily, contact your domestic insurance service provider to see if you can get a 90-day supply of medication before departure, making sure compliance with Spanish customs policies concerning personal medication allowances.
- Building a Relationship with a Local Pharmacist: Local farmacia staff are incredibly useful. If you run low on a medication while waiting for a medical professional's visit, Spanish pharmacists will frequently supply a bridging dose in emergency scenarios, provided you reveal the empty product packaging or a foreign prescription.
